  • The education that occurs immediately following completion of secondary school or high school that leads to a bachelor’s degree.
  • An undergraduate degree (also called first degree or simply degree) is a colloquial term for an academic degree taken by a person who has completed undergraduate courses. It is usually offered at an institution of higher education, such as a university.
  • A course of study or programme of research leading to a Bachelor’s Degree (see Bachelor’s Degree).

Bin Yan is a Ph.D. student in Architecture who is studying at the T.C. Chan Center. She received her undergraduate degree from Tsinghua University in the Department of Building Science. She received seven scholarships to attend school. When she isn’t doing research, Bin enjoys taking walks and capturing beautiful natural scenes with her camera, cooking for friends, and talking about her studies, research and books. Since visiting the Philadelphia Orchestra, Bin was inspired by the music and started to learn to play the piano. Your current research topic is Uncertainty Analysis of Energy Consumption Prediction of HVAC Systems. How did you decide to study this topic? The problem of uncertainty bothers me a lot. Uncertainty is everywhere, not just in research or study. For example, what I will do after graduation is a super big uncertainty. In a smaller aspect, whether I will catch a cold tomorrow is also uncertain. What I am learning is how I can live in a world where nothing is certain. Dr. Malkawi suggested that I explore this interest by looking into the uncertainty problem in my field. I think it is really a good idea since he suggested. I am excited to officially investigate something that I am always trying to manage. It even occurred to me that maybe I will become a more optimistic person after I finish my thesis since I will have a better understanding of uncertainty. Of course, there are also very solid academic reasons for choosing this topic. When I was an undergraduate, I was very confused about the inputs for building simulations. I felt frustrated that there is no way to make sure that my inputs are exactly the same as, or even very close to the reality. And then I was not confident about my results. As my experience accumulates, I started to realize how data can be manipulated. So the question of how a simulation with so much uncertainty can be applied in order to make better decision is important. What's more, this research issue hasn’t drawn enough attention and has not been solved. Prof. Yi Jiang from Tsinghua University also encouraged me to look into this topic. He hopes that when I solve this problem, I can think more about fundamental principles of the system. My background is in HVAC systems, which helps me in the practical applications of my studies. Building simulation is a field that deals with energy conservation and sustainability, so it is it is definitely worth my effort. What is one of the major challenges in your research? I am trying to apply Machine Learning to my research. Machine learning is a scientific discipline that is focused on the computer designs evolve behaviors based on data, such as from sensor data. Machine Learning can help with difficult simulations that are based on real time data. Machine Learning is complex and challenging and can be misunderstood. I hope I will have chances to discuss my studies with more people in order to get better ideas and improve my research. What are you hoping to learn from your research? Knowledge about HVAC systems and Machine Learning is important and fascinating. But the most important thing is the method of doing research. So far I really enjoy it, because I feel I am learning something new and interesting every day. How do you think that your research will have an impact on sustainability? If I can clarify the uncertainty issue well, it can be applied to simulation calibration and system fault detection in HVAC systems. Application of this research will help save energy and improve sustainability. A Why did you choose to study at the T.C. Chan Center? Its reputation. Prof. Yi Jiang from Tsinghua University recommended me to Dr. Ali Malkawi at the Center. I am grateful to have this chance to study here. After you graduate, what are your plans for the future? I hope I can continue to research in this field, learn something new and interesting everyday, and enjoy doing research!

When first-year biology students signed up for Professor Buck Sanford's newest class, they really signed up for something bigger: a real-life probe into global warming. Professor Buck Sanford and students measure tree buds as part of Project Budburst, a real-life probe into global warming. For their class lab work, students measured tree buds as leaves emerged this spring and uploaded their data into global databases. Scientists around the world will study the records of bud development to see if global warming is affecting how early tree leaves emerge. "These measurements really do matter," Sanford warned his students as they prepared for their first day of data collection. "The data you collect will be studied by a global community of scientists, a community that you are now part of." The research process in the field Every tree on campus is tagged with a number, so students in future generations can find the exact same tree today's students are studying. Each student in Sanford's class selected a bud on a tree and tagged the area so the same bud could be revisited. Then, for five weeks, students measured their selected bud three times a week and charted its growth as a leaf emerged and started to grow. First-year student Larisa Clark collects measurements to add to the Project Budburst database. The students then logged on a Web site and uploaded their weekly findings. Scientists worldwide can access the database and analyze the measurements for decades to come to look for trends in bud growth over time. Briefing the new students, teaching assistant Kris Veo stressed the importance of gathering good information. "This is kind of a big deal," he said. "This is why you need to be vigilant and get good data... it's not just for a grade this time. What you're doing is contributing to a global database. These people are relying on you." Project BudBurst Sanford's students are part of a campaign called Project BudBurst, led by Sandra Henderson, a science educator at the University Corporation for Atmospheric Research (UCAR) Office of Education and Outreach in Boulder, Colo. BudBurst gathers data in a scientific field called phenology, the study of the influence of climate on annual natural events, such as plant budding and bird migration. With an army of 180 students that took Sanford's labs in the spring quarter, and DU's collection of documented and protected trees in the campus-wide arboretum, the University can provide Project BudBurst with a wealth of data about bud activity in Denver every spring. Sanford is committed to continuing the data collection with his classes every year. First-year student Aaron Hogan, who's working toward a degree in ecology, says he enjoys getting out in the field and doing real research. Hogan says he hopes his study of life and biodiversity will help him in his career. "I think it's good that our work will help others and add to the information that's out there." Sanford says his class isn't pushing any one theory of global warming. Rather, it's testing the hypothesis that something is altering the life cycle of plants around the world.
